在信息化的今天,数据库作为存储和管理数据的基石,已经成为各行各业不可或缺的部分。数据库查询命令是数据库操作的核心,它能够帮助我们快速准确地获取所需数据。本文将全面解析数据库查询命令的技巧,帮助您掌握数据库查看引擎的强大功能。
一、数据库查询基础
在开始深入探讨查询技巧之前,我们需要了解一些数据库查询的基础知识。
1. SQL语句
SQL(Structured Query Language)是一种用于数据库管理的标准语言,包括数据查询、数据更新、数据删除等操作。掌握SQL语句是进行数据库查询的前提。
2. 数据库类型
目前常见的数据库类型有MySQL、Oracle、SQL Server、PostgreSQL等。不同类型的数据库在语法和功能上可能存在差异,但基本的查询原理是相通的。
3. 数据表和字段
数据表是数据库中的基本存储单位,字段则是表中的列,代表数据的属性。
二、数据库查询命令技巧
1. SELECT语句
SELECT语句用于查询数据库中的数据,以下是一些常用技巧:
1.1 选择特定字段
SELECT column1, column2 FROM table_name;
1.2 选择所有字段
SELECT * FROM table_name;
1.3 条件查询
SELECT column1, column2 FROM table_name WHERE condition;
1.4 排序查询
SELECT column1, column2 FROM table_name ORDER BY column1 ASC/DESC;
1.5 聚合函数
SELECT COUNT(column1), SUM(column2) FROM table_name;
2. WHERE语句
WHERE语句用于在查询时设置条件,以下是一些技巧:
2.1 简单条件
SELECT column1, column2 FROM table_name WHERE column1 = value;
2.2 复合条件
SELECT column1, column2 FROM table_name WHERE column1 = value AND column2 = value;
2.3 通配符查询
SELECT column1, column2 FROM table_name WHERE column1 LIKE '%pattern%';
3. JOIN语句
JOIN语句用于连接两个或多个表,以下是一些技巧:
3.1 内连接
SELECT column1, column2 FROM table1 INNER JOIN table2 ON table1.column1 = table2.column1;
3.2 左连接
SELECT column1, column2 FROM table1 LEFT JOIN table2 ON table1.column1 = table2.column1;
3.3 右连接
SELECT column1, column2 FROM table1 RIGHT JOIN table2 ON table1.column1 = table2.column1;
4. 子查询
子查询可以嵌套在其他SQL语句中,用于实现更复杂的查询逻辑。
5. GROUP BY和HAVING语句
GROUP BY语句用于对查询结果进行分组,HAVING语句用于在分组后筛选结果。
三、总结
数据库查询命令技巧是数据库操作的重要组成部分,掌握这些技巧能够帮助我们更加高效地获取所需数据。在实际应用中,根据不同的业务需求和数据特点,灵活运用各种查询技巧,将大大提高数据库操作的效率。
希望本文能够帮助您全面解析数据库查询命令技巧,提升您的数据库操作能力。
